RESUMEN

A practical and efficient protocol toward fully substituted isothiazolones through Selectfluor-mediated intramolecular oxidative annulation of α-carbamoyl ketene dithioacetals has been developed in the presence of H2O and metal-free conditions. Notably, the experimental results reveal that H2O was crucial to the formation of new N-S bonds and the elimination of alkyl group from the sulfur atom. This protocol provides readily prepared substrates and possesses good functional group tolerance, mild reaction conditions, and operational simplicity, which provides potential access to applications in the pharmaceutical chemistry.

RESUMEN

AIM:To detect the expression of caspase 3 gene in primary human hepatocellular carcinoma (HCC) and investigate its relationship top21(WAF1) gene expression and HCC apoptosis.METHODS:In situ hybridization was employed to determine caspase 3 and p21(WAF1) expression in HCC.In situ end-labeling was used to detect hepatocytic apoptosis in HCC.RESULTS:Twenty-one of 39 (53.8%) cases of HCC were found to express caspase 3 transcripts, while 46.2% of HCC failed to express caspase 3.Non-cancerous adjacent liver tissues showed more positive caspase 3(87.5%, 7/8) as compared with HCC (p < 0.05). The expression of caspase 3 is correlated with HCC differentiation, 72.2% (13/18) of moderately to highly differentiated HCC showed caspase 3 transcripts positive, while only 38.1% of poorly differentiated HCC harbored caspase 3 transcripts (italic>p < 0.05). No relationship was found between caspase 3 expression and tumor size or grade or metastasis, although 62.5% (5/8) of HCC with metastasis were caspase 3 positive and a little higher than that with no metastasis (51.6%, p> 0.05). Expression of caspase 3 alone did not affect the apoptosis index (AI) of HCC. The AI was 7.12 in caspase 3 positive tumors (n = 21), while in caspase 3-negative cases (n = 18) 6.59 (italic>p > 0.05). Expression of caspase 3 clearly segregated with p21(WAF1) positive tumors as compared with p21(WAF1) negative cases (16 of 23, 69.6% versus 5 of 16, 31.3%) with statistical significance (p = 0.017).In the cases with positive caspase 3 and negative p21(WAF1), the AI was found slightly higher, but with no statistical significance, than that with expres-sion of p21(WAF1) and caspase 3 (7.21 vs 6.98 , p>0.05).CONCLUSION:Loss of caspase 3 expression may contribute to HCC carcinogenesis, although the expression of caspase 3 does not correlate well with cell apoptosis in HCC.p21(WAF1) may be merely one of the inhibitors which can reduce caspase 3 mediated cell apoptosis in HCCs.
